Plot Summary

A struggling Canadian heavy metal band named "The Winners" embarks on a desperate tour across the United States in hopes of achieving fame. They soon discover that the only way to get ahead is by making a deal with a mysterious woman who promises them success in exchange for their blood, revealing herself to be a vampire. The band must then battle their way through the music industry and vampire hunters alike.
